Hannah Harper is officially the next American Idol. The 25-year-old from Missouri won season 24 of the singing competition on Monday, May 11, beating out Jordan McCullough (runner-up) and Keyla Richardson (third place).
The three-hour finale ended with Harper performing Chris Tomlin’s “At The Cross (Love Ran Red)” in tears, as her fellow contestants joined her on stage.
Hannah Harper The Audition That Left Carrie Underwood in Tears

Harper’s journey to the Idol crown started with an original song called “String Cheese.” And yes, you read that right. The song was about her personal struggle with postpartum depression.
Here’s how she explained it during her audition:
“I was sitting on my couch wallowing. I have boys, you know. Everybody wants to touch you, and I didn’t want to be touched. My youngest son kept coming up to me. I was just having a pity party, praying that the Lord would calm my spirit.”
Then her son said something that changed everything.
“He said, ‘Mom, open this. Open my cheese.’ I’m like, ‘Leave me alone with the doggone cheese.'”
But she opened it. And that simple moment became a turning point.
“I finally opened his cheese, and when I did, I realized God had put me in that place. Where I was in my house was the biggest ministry I could ever have – being a mom. So I gathered myself, got up off the couch, quit throwing a pity party, and kicked postpartum depression in the butt.”
Carrie Underwood’s Emotional Reaction

Carrie Underwood called it “the most relatable song” she’d ever heard.
“You’re gorgeous. You look famous already,” Underwood told Harper. “I just think you have a beautiful simplicity to your voice. You’re one that I’m going to think about when we leave here. I wonder what song she’s gonna sing next.”
She added, “I feel like I’m gonna be just rooting for you. I love everything about everything you just did. I’ll go first – it’s a yes from me.”
